    Let me preface with my credentials - 15 years up the pole & in the hole, coax cable lineman, splicing, maintenance, etc...
    Those look like the 16" Hoffman pole climbers, which I have a pair. They came with the 'claw' sole, which wore down rather quickly - I had them resoled with the vibram. They are still around, but I have moved on to Wesco for their custom options.
    My personal opinion, in the context of pole climbing, is that there is no better boot for that price range.
